A member asked:

My skin has been itching from quite a long time. i have takena lot of medicines but could not find a permanent fix. i took cetrizine and allegra (fexofenadine) 180 for over a year. what should i do?

6 doctors weighed in across 4 answers
Dr. Robert Kent answered

Specializes in Physical & Rehabilitation Medicine

Any other meds?: If not on other meds, and continued itching after symptomatic treatment, look toward environmental issues such as detergents, even infestations if lesions present. If nothing else found, make sure you check with your primary. Certain other issues, such as liver failure, can lead to itchy skin, but doubt that would be your only sign. Most likely environmental issues.

Get a physical: Sometimes, itching can be due to problems other than allergies. Problems with your liver can cause itching. Get a physical and have some blood work.

OTC: Those are otc meds so i assume you have not seen a doc. See an allergist or dermatologist but also make sure you have a chemistry and a TSH done.
